Output 40aba4f31ac3bbcecb8efc13f66d380c7e2e6090a40be934477c0c90e0d2a08c:1

value
1999344
script pubkey
OP_0 OP_PUSHBYTES_20 95a9a77b51484c2dde7d87aa8c89e2e86e3dcf86
address
bc1qjk56w763fpxzmhnas74gez0zaphrmnux5khkrt
transaction
40aba4f31ac3bbcecb8efc13f66d380c7e2e6090a40be934477c0c90e0d2a08c
confirmations
339236
spent
true